How Real Estate Owners Lose Income When Climate Events Disrupt Operations
When extreme weather affects a property, tenants still expect service, facilities still require maintenance, and operating costs continue. Property owners absorb lost income, unexpected expenses, and disruption-related costs long before any insurance payout arrives.
Where Traditional Insurance Falls Short: The Real Estate Coverage Gap
Property insurance was designed around repairing damaged buildings and replacing physical assets. However, the financial impact of climate events often appears in the form of tenant disruption, emergency operating costs, increased maintenance expenses, and reduced property utilisation.
Real estate climate risk protection through parametric insurance solves this by changing the trigger entirely. When a defined weather event occurs at your property's PIN code and is verified by IMD or ERA5 data, your payout is released automatically.

Why Traditional Property Insurance Falls Short During Climate Events
Traditional insurance payouts generally require evidence of physical damage, followed by inspections, surveys, and claim assessments. Property owners may need to submit repair estimates, maintenance records, photographs, and supporting documentation before receiving compensation.
Many weather-related operational expenses do not qualify as direct physical loss. Parametric insurance eliminates these limitations with objective weather data, automatic payouts, zero documentation, hyperlocal pricing, and transparent trigger-based settlements.

What’s Covered
Every Weather Risk That Can Impact
Property Operations
Each real estate climate risk protection policy is triggered by objective and verified weather data. The trigger is defined precisely in your policy document at purchase. If the data crosses your threshold, you are paid, leaving no room for ambiguity.
You can purchase a single-peril policy for a specific exposure period, or combine multiple perils to protect a property throughout the year.
Weather Peril | Trigger Definition | Data Source |
|---|---|---|
Floods & Flash Floods | Rainfall at your property's PIN code exceeds your selected threshold (mm/24 hrs) in a single day or rolling period | IMD |
Heatwaves | Daily maximum temperature exceeds your Strike Point (°C) for a defined number of days | ERA5 |
Extreme Rainfall | Cumulative rainfall exceeds the defined volume within a selected coverage window | IMD |
Cyclones | Rainfall and cyclone track validated against IMD advisory data crosses your defined threshold for the property zone | IMD |
Cold Waves | Minimum temperature falls below your threshold (°C) for a sustained period in exposed locations | ERA5 |

No. Parametric real estate insurance complements traditional property insurance rather than replacing it. Traditional insurance remains important for protecting buildings, infrastructure, and physical assets. Parametric insurance provides rapid access to funds when weather events disrupt property operations, helping owners and managers respond immediately without waiting for traditional claim settlements.
Policy issuance requires only your property's PIN code and basic KYC details. No property valuation reports, inspection certificates, or prior insurance records are needed. The entire process is digital and completed in approximately 5 minutes.
Tax treatment of parametric payouts depends on your entity type and how the funds are used. We recommend consulting your tax advisor, as payouts received as compensation for operational losses may be treated differently from investment income.
